Product Introduction

The yeast disc separator is a specialized type of nozzle slag discharge separator. It is widely utilized for solid phase concentration in suspensions and light phase concentration in emulsions. Key applications include the separation and concentration of various yeasts, clarification of clay and pigment-contaminated water, and the recycling of catalysts and high polymer powders. This makes it essential equipment for yeast production, alcohol manufacturing, breweries, and environmental protection sectors.

These starch separators operate at high speeds with continuous nozzle discharge. The disc centrifuge is designed for starch purification, preconcentration, protein separation, and starch recovery. It also serves industries such as medicine, dyeing, and kaolin pulp recycling for liquid-solid two-phase separation and clarification.

Yeast Disc Stack Centrifuge

Nozzle separators are continuously operating disk centrifuges built as centrifugal clarifiers and separators. They are more solids-oriented than self-cleaning separators. When configured as clarifiers, they function as concentrators to thicken solids from suspensions. They are absolute specialists in processing fermentation products in biotechnology, pharmaceutical, and food industries.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the primary use of a yeast disc separator?
It is primarily used for the separation and concentration of yeast, clarification of liquids in fermentation processes, and recovery of catalysts or polymers in various industrial applications.
What materials are used in the construction of the separator?
The equipment is manufactured using high-quality 304 or 316L food-grade stainless steel to ensure durability and compliance with hygiene standards.
How is the discharge process managed?
The machine features an automatic nozzle slag discharge system, allowing for continuous operation without manual intervention for waste removal.
Does the machine support automated control?
Yes, the separator is equipped with a PLC control box for precise and automated management of the separation process.
What kind of bearings are used in this equipment?
We use high-performance SKF bearings to ensure high-speed stability, reduced noise, and a longer service life for the drum assembly.
Can this machine handle both two-phase and three-phase separation?
Depending on the specific model and configuration, the machine can be used for both liquid-solid (two-phase) and liquid-liquid-solid (three-phase) separation.
